BOOT UP! IT’S THE BIG ONE…

30 pairs, five writers, hundreds of miles: welcome to the biggest boot test in Country Walking history.

-

So, you’ve got the shopping tips and the fitting advice, and you know what makes a boot tick. Now it’s time to see what’s available out there. Our test includes 30 hiking boots ranging in price from £50 to £250, from country casual and urban explorer up to multi-day trekker. Since the start of 2022, our team of reviewers have been taking them out around the country to face every possible terrain from woods and farmland to Lake District mountains (and in all weathers too). Here’s a quick guide as to how the test works.

GENDER

Most boots are available in men’s and women’s versions, as denoted by these dots next to the boot name.

TARGET PRICE

We’ve listed the recommende­d retail price (RRP) and a Target Price based on what we’ve seen online and in stores, but not any sale prices we find as these are usually only temporary. Generally, unless a boot is brand new to the market, you should be able to find it for less than the RRP – and often a fair bit less.

OUR TESTERS

Our testing team of Tom Bailey (TB), Rachel Broomhead (RB), Liz Hallissey

(LH), Nick Hallissey (NH) and Philip Thomas (PT) have taken these boots to as many different terrains as possible, including the Brecon Beacons, Devon coast, the Highlands, Snowdonia, the Peak District, Northumber­land, the South and North Downs, the Yorkshire Dales, the Lincolnshi­re Wolds, and the cities of London, York and Bristol.

RATINGS

Each boot is rated for Comfort,

Support, Versatilit­y and Value for Money. We don’t pick an overall winner because no single option will suit everyone, but at the end of the review you’ll find our Best in Class choices for each category.
